Watch Roisin Murphy at LowLands Festival

Check out a live recording of Roisin Murphy performing a fantastic extended version of "Tell Everybody" at LowLands Festival this past weekend in The Netherlands. She had the crowd at her feet. "It must be the weed," she jokes at the end of the song.

"Tell Everybody" is taken from the singer's "Overpowered" album and was written by Murphy together with Timbaland collaborator Jimmy Douglas (Nelly Furtado, Missy Elliot) and Ill factor last summer in Miami.

Her gig at LowLands is one of Murphy's final European festival appearances. Next month, she will taking off from music for a few weeks. "(. . .) September is fashion month all over the world," she told me recently in an interview. "I am going to go and do some fashion things, stop thinking about music for a while, start thinking about dresses and hats again."

Expect more from Murphy in October when her song "Movie Star" will be featured in a global Gucci fragrance commercial in conjunction with the release of a live DVD and a promotional blitz in the United States.
